Highlights
Are people in Frankfort older or younger than people in Monticello?
- The Median Age in Frankfort is 10.4 years younger than in Monticello.

Are housing costs cheaper in Frankfort or Monticello?
- Frankfort housing costs are 13.8% less expensive than Monticello hous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Frankfort or Monticello?
- The average commute for residents of Frankfort is 4.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Monticello.

Things to do in Monticello?
Living in Monticello, IN is a great experience. It is a small town with a welcoming and friendly atmosphere, where everyone knows your name. You can take advantage of the many outdoor activities available in the area, from hiking and biking trails to fishing and boating on Lake Shafer. The downtown area offers unique restaurants and shopping experiences as well as numerous festivals throughout the year. Education is important here with schools that offer quality academics as well as extracurricular activities for students to participate in. Overall, Monticello is a great place to live for families or individuals looking for a small town feel with plenty of amenities.
